More Americans than ever are paying attention to corporate workspace transformation, and WeWork sits at the center of this evolution. After a challenging IPO and significant financial restructuring, the company’s stock has stabilized after years of steep declines. This shift mirrors a renewed interest in flexible work models and the long-term reimagining of office demand—factors that now shape corporate real estate strategies nationwide. As remote and hybrid work become standard, stocks like WeWork’s are seen as barometers of how the modern workplace is adapting.
